I am creating a form to allow input from either of 2 seperate cells.
Example:a1=b1, b1=a1 , when entering in either cell it is copied to the
other. I need to suppres the circular reference error in both cells with
a
blank ("").
I get 0 instead of blanks with the following:
[a1] =IF(ISERROR(B1),"",B1)
[b1] =IF(ISERROR(A1),"",A1)
